Как создать новые корневые папки в исходном элементе Team Project?
Я хотел бы воссоздать иерархию папок, как в этом примере (из Руководство по ветвлению TFS Главная 2010 v1):
![enter image description here]()
Проблема заключается в том, что я не могу понять, как создавать дополнительные папки на корневом уровне, такие как Разработка и Отпустить на рисунке выше, чтобы добавить новые дочерние ветки.
Параметр команды New Folder
становится доступным только на уровнях ниже корневых ветвей.
Как создать новые корневые папки в исходном элементе Team Project на уровне главного сервера?
Ответы
Ответ 1
Убедитесь, что ваше рабочее пространство отображается на уровне Team Project ( "StandardBranchPlan" на картинке). Я просто попробовал это и обнаружил, что "Новая папка" не появляется, если я выбрал неправильное рабочее пространство, но как только я выбираю рабочую область, которая отображает папку, в которой я хочу создать новую папку, "Новая папка" активизировалась.
Ответ 2
Вы не можете добавить папку в корневую папку в TFS к неотображаемому, как упоминалось выше. Однако один хороший способ сделать это - в следующем примере.
Сценарий:
- Вы хотите, чтобы NEW Folder содержала много новых проектов.
- Щелкните правой кнопкой мыши по вашему решению и добавьте решение в исходный элемент управления
- На этом этапе вы можете создать папку в корневом каталоге с именем "WebServices"
- Затем вы продолжите всплывающее окно с добавлением в проект/решение
Для меня это прекрасно работает, хотя я тоже предпочел бы свободу заранее установить структуру папок для себя и других разработчиков без необходимости совершать/проверять код и т.д.